Initially, digital storefronts operated with minimal scrutiny regarding age verification and product licensing. However, a bipartisan coalition of 25 U.S. state attorneys general recently exerted intense legal pressure on major hosting platforms. These lawmakers successfully pushed for stricter enforcement against merchants distributing unlicensed e-cigarettes. Consequently, platforms like Shopify decided to implement a comprehensive online vape ban. This policy will prohibit all e-cigarette transactions, regardless of whether the products possess regulatory clearance. Public health officials warmly welcome this move, as it directly impacts the distribution of unauthorized devices. Many of these products originate from unregulated manufacturing facilities overseas, particularly in China. Consequently, they often contain unknown chemical concentrations that pose severe respiratory risks. By removing these merchants, digital platforms are actively supporting law enforcement efforts. Furthermore, this action creates a powerful precedent for other e-commerce providers. When infrastructure companies refuse to host illicit operations, they effectively choke the supply chain. Ultimately, this proactive stance protects vulnerable consumer demographics, especially teenagers, from accessing hazardous materials online and developing life-long nicotine addictions. In addition to e-commerce hosting platforms, financial institutions are tightening their compliance requirements. For example, Mastercard recently issued a global warning to its acquiring partners. This notice emphasized that facilitating unauthorized e-cigarette sales directly violates network standards. Therefore, financial intermediaries must implement robust monitoring controls to verify merchant inventories. If an acquirer registers a non-compliant retailer, they face substantial financial penalties. Consequently, payment processors are now scrutinizing digital invoices and transaction logs with unprecedented diligence. This coordinated effort between payment networks and hosting platforms creates a double-layered barrier for illicit vendors. Furthermore, when major credit card brands withdraw their services, underground merchants lose their primary revenue collection method. As a result, they must resort to less secure or less convenient payment alternatives. This shift significantly reduces their overall sales volume and deters average consumers. Ultimately, the integration of financial policing with digital hosting bans represents a highly effective regulatory synergy. By targeting both the transaction processing and the storefront hosting, authorities are successfully dismantling the commercial infrastructure of illegal vaping. Consequently, these financial restrictions bolster broader public safety initiatives.
While the current platform ban focuses heavily on the United States, e-cigarette regulations vary globally. For instance, countries like India have enacted total prohibitions on the sale, manufacture, and advertisement of all vaping products. Similarly, Australia has restricted vape sales exclusively to pharmacies, requiring a valid medical prescription. In contrast, other European nations permit regulated sales but impose strict nicotine limits and advertising bans. These diverse legal frameworks force multinational e-commerce platforms to constantly adjust their enforcement strategies. Additionally, the proliferation of illegal devices often stems from the slow pace of official marketing authorizations. Tobacco manufacturers argue that slow regulatory approvals inadvertently fuel the demand for underground alternatives. However, public health advocates counter that rigorous clinical trials are essential to protect consumers from long-term harm. Therefore, international regulators continue to debate the ideal balance between harm reduction and market control. As digital platforms implement borderless policies, they must align with these differing national laws. Ultimately, global coordination remains essential to successfully eradicate the illicit international trade of unsafe nicotine products. Thus, global harmony in healthcare policies remains vital.
Despite these substantial restrictions, completely eliminating illegal vaping products remains a monumental challenge. Specifically, many illicit manufacturers quickly adapt to regulatory crackdowns by shifting to alternative marketing channels. For example, social media platforms and encrypted messaging applications frequently serve as informal marketplaces. Furthermore, brick-and-mortar convenience stores and gas stations still account for the majority of unauthorized sales. Therefore, physical enforcement actions must accompany digital platform policies. In addition, the highly lucrative nature of the illegal market continues to attract persistent operators. British American Tobacco estimates that the illegal e-cigarette market in the United States alone is worth billions. This massive financial incentive means that when one digital storefront closes, another often emerges under a different name. Consequently, law enforcement agencies must continuously collaborate with private technology companies to monitor evasion tactics. In the long run, education and public awareness campaigns are just as critical as technological bans. By educating young consumers about the clinical dangers of unverified devices, society can reduce the underlying demand. Therefore, collaborative education remains a central preventive pillar.
